On 5/3/24 20:15, Ryan Roberts wrote: > As preparation for the next patch, which frees up the PTE_PROT_NONE > present pte and swap pte bit, generalize PMD_PRESENT_INVALID to > PTE_PRESENT_INVALID. This will then be used to mark PROT_NONE ptes (and > entries at any other level) in the next patch. > > While we're at it, fix up the swap pte format comment to include > PTE_PRESENT_INVALID. This is not new, it just wasn't previously > documented. > > Reviewed-by: Catalin Marinas <catalin.marinas@arm.com> > Signed-off-by: Ryan Roberts <ryan.roberts@arm.com>
